Motorcars and beauty industries account for the highest number of complaints in 2019, prepayment losses suffered by consumers at estimated $2.37 million
The motorcars industry accounted for the highest number of complaints received by the Consumers Association of Singapore (“CASE”) in 2019, with 42% of complaints involving defective or non- conforming goods. The beauty industry accounted for the second highest number of complaints, with one-third of them involving pressure sales tactics. The amount of prepayment losses suffered by consumers were at an estimated $2.37 million.
